Heat Resistance

Granite and quartz countertops are incredibly resistant to heat, particularly granite. Meaning they deal with hot pans and dishes without damage, offering a convenient solution for busy kitchens. While quartz is more resistant to heat than many materials, it’s best to use heat pads or trivets to protect it from direct high heat exposure.

Minimal Care Required

Quartz worktops are non-porous, which means they don’t require sealing and are resistant to stains, making them incredibly low-maintenance. While granite is porous, it only needs sealing once a year to retain its stain resistance. Both stones are easy to clean with only soap and water, providing hassle-free upkeep.

Perfectly Hygenic Surfaces

Due to their non-porous nature, quartz worktops combat the growth of bacteria, mould, and mildew, this makes them an extremely hygienic choice for kitchens and bathrooms. Granite, once sealed, is also extremely imperveous to bacteria, providing a sanitary and safe area for food preparation.

Bespoke Options

One of the great thing about quartz, you have the ability to customise the appearance of the counter to suit your design preferences. As a manufactured stone, it’s available in a vast range of colours, patterns, and finishes. Granite’s natural appeal is that no two slabs are identical, providing a one-of-a-kind look that’s unique to your home.

Resistant to Scratching

Both quartz and granite worktops are tremendously resistant to scratches, meaning they’ll keep their smooth surface even after years of use. Quartz’s non-porous structure also means it’s extremely resistant to stains from things like wine, coffee, or oil, making quartz a brilliant choice for messy cooks.
